My battery on my X has been draining rather quickly lately. I usually can not even get to 8pm before its at 5% if I watch a video on Youtube it drains 1% about every 2-3 minutes and just browsing apps it does the same thing. I have the most recent ios 13.2 update and nothing seems to be getting better. I have location services set to only work when in an app, i have my brightness below 50%, and I have app refresh off.

Any ideas on what I can do? battery health is 88% and says it is working correctly at peak performance.
